This is a project that i recently finished up.It's a copy of a Sterling Silver Reliquary that was recently unearthed in the grave of Captain Gabriel Archer at Jamestowne VA.Bit of a stretch for a longrifle accoutrement but a very interesting piece of history nonetheless......Mine is a slightly larger version and I've included a photo of the original for comparison.Also here is a link to information about the original http://historicjamestowne.org/archaeology/chancel-burials/archaeology/reliquary/ (http://historicjamestowne.org/archaeology/chancel-burials/archaeology/reliquary/)

Nicely done Mitch. I am especially interested as I followed the find of this reliquary in the dig at Jamestown. I also recall the controversy of a Catholic relic in what was known to be a Protestant Anglican community of entrepreneurs. You really nailed the design and craftsmanship.
